Former AFL CEO Ratu Sakiusa Tuisolia has resigned as President of the Fiji Rugby Union.

In a statement, Ratu Tuisolia confirms he has taken this step to ensure that the hard work and recent achievements of the FRU does not have a negative impact through the politically motivated charges brought against him by the Fiji Independent Commission Against Corruption.

He said he intends to mount a legal challenge against the 44 charges laid against him and believes that the rugby fraternity be given the opportunity to elect a new President of the FRU.
